Golden Eagles Take Revenge Against Rebels, 6-2: Game Recap

The No. 19 Southern Miss Golden Eagles defeated No. 18 Ole Miss, 6-2, on Tuesday night at Trustmark Park.

It’s a revenge game for the Golden Eagles, who lost to the Rebels 15-8 on the road on February 25. Therefore, winning Tuesday’s game lifted a huge weight off their shoulders.

The Golden Eagles improve to 15-6 in the season, 2-1 in conference play. Playing at home brings out the best out of them since they’re 12-3 at home. 

Matthew Adams took the Mount for the Golden Eagles. Through 4.2 innings, he gave up six hits and two runs and struck out three batters. Five pitchers were used for the Golden Eagles. Colby Allen got the save, allowed just two hits, and struck out one batter.

The Golden Eagles attacked first in the first inning with two runs. The Rebels responded with two runs of their own in the top of the 3rd inning. However, the damage was done in the bottom of the fifth inning when the Golden Eagles erupted for four runs. 

Shortstop Ozzie Pratt went 2-for-4 with an RBI. Davis Gillespie had 3 RBIs. Second baseman Nick Monistere and infielder Carson Paetow also picked up RBIs for the Golden Eagles. 

Rebels starting pitcher Cade Townsend allowed two earned runs and recorded five strikeouts through three innings. Relievers Gunnar Dennis, Will McCausland, Hudson Calhoun, and Taylor Rabe combined for nine strikeouts. 

Dennis is the only pitcher out of the bullpen that allowed runs. He gave up four earned runs, which came in the fifth. 

Rebels infielder Mitchell Sanford drove the only two runs for the team. He finished the game going 2-for-4 with two RBIs.

The Golden Eagles will travel to Monroe to take on the University of Louisiana on Friday, March 21, at 6 pm EST. The Golden Eagles could use this as another revenge game since ULM won the previous match last April. 

The Rebels dropped to 15-5 and now have a three-game losing streak. They will take on Missouri on Friday night to begin a three-game series.
